An AI consultant is a professional who:
- Advises businesses on integrating AI technologies.
- Develop AI strategies to enhance operations and decision-making.
- Implements AI solutions tailored to specific industry needs.
- Evaluate and improve existing AI systems for optimization.
- Bridges the gap between technical AI capabilities and business objectives.
AI Consulting
Key Responsibilities of an AI Consultant
1. Problem Identification and Solution Development
- Problem Identification: AI consultants work closely with clients to understand their unique challenges and identify areas where AI can provide value. This involves conducting thorough assessments of existing processes and systems to pinpoint inefficiencies, bottlenecks, and opportunities for improvement.
- Solution Development: Once the problems are identified, AI consultants develop tailored AI solutions to address them. This may involve creating predictive models, designing automated workflows, or developing custom algorithms to optimize operations.
2. Strategy Formulation and Implementation
- Strategy Formulation: AI consultants help businesses formulate comprehensive AI strategies aligning with their objectives. This includes setting clear goals, defining key performance indicators (KPIs), and creating a roadmap for AI adoption and integration.
- Implementation: After the strategy is developed, AI consultants oversee the implementation of AI solutions. They ensure the necessary infrastructure, tools, and technologies are in place and work seamlessly with existing systems.
3. Technology Integration and Optimization
- Integration: AI consultants integrate AI technologies into the client’s infrastructure, ensuring compatibility and minimizing disruption. This may involve integrating AI with data management systems, enterprise resource planning (ERP) software, and customer relationship management (CRM) platforms.
- Optimization: AI consultants continuously monitor and optimize AI solutions to ensure they operate at peak performance. This includes fine-tuning algorithms, improving data quality, and adjusting based on real-time feedback and performance metrics.
4. Training and Support
- Training: AI consultants provide training and support to help clients and their teams understand and effectively use AI technologies. This includes developing training programs, conducting workshops, and providing hands-on guidance to ensure users are comfortable with the new tools and processes.
- Support: AI consultants offer ongoing support to address any issues that arise and ensure the long-term success of AI initiatives. This includes troubleshooting technical problems, updating AI models, and providing guidance on best practices for AI management and governance.
AI Consulting
Definition of AI Consulting
AI consulting involves providing expert advice and solutions to organizations seeking to integrate artificial intelligence (AI) technologies into their operations.
AI consultants leverage their expertise in machine learning, data science, and software engineering to help businesses harness AI’s power for improved decision-making, efficiency, and innovation.
They offer strategic guidance, technical support, and implementation services to ensure that AI initiatives align with business goals and deliver measurable results.
Key Responsibilities of an AI Consultant
1. Problem Identification and Solution Development
- Problem Identification: AI consultants work closely with clients to understand their unique challenges and identify areas where AI can provide value. This involves conducting thorough assessments of existing processes and systems to pinpoint inefficiencies, bottlenecks, and opportunities for improvement.
- Solution Development: Once the problems are identified, AI consultants develop tailored AI solutions to address them. This may involve creating predictive models, designing automated workflows, or developing custom algorithms to optimize operations.
2. Strategy Formulation and Implementation
- Strategy Formulation: AI consultants help businesses formulate comprehensive AI strategies aligning with their objectives. This includes setting clear goals, defining key performance indicators (KPIs), and creating a roadmap for AI adoption and integration.
- Implementation: After the strategy is developed, AI consultants oversee the implementation of AI solutions. They ensure the necessary infrastructure, tools, and technologies are in place and work seamlessly with existing systems.
3. Technology Integration and Optimization
- Integration: AI consultants integrate AI technologies into the client’s infrastructure, ensuring compatibility and minimizing disruption. This may involve integrating AI with data management systems, enterprise resource planning (ERP) software, and customer relationship management (CRM) platforms.
- Optimization: AI consultants continuously monitor and optimize AI solutions to ensure they operate at peak performance. This includes fine-tuning algorithms, improving data quality, and adjusting based on real-time feedback and performance metrics.
4. Training and Support
- Training: AI consultants provide training and support to help clients and their teams understand and effectively use AI technologies. This includes developing training programs, conducting workshops, and providing hands-on guidance to ensure users are comfortable with the new tools and processes.
- Support: AI consultants offer ongoing support to address any issues that arise and ensure the long-term success of AI initiatives. This includes troubleshooting technical problems, updating AI models, and providing guidance on best practices for AI management and governance.
The Role of an AI Consultant
Analyzing Business Needs and Identifying Opportunities for AI Applications
AI consultants start by analyzing the business needs of their clients. They conduct detailed assessments to understand the current state of operations, identify pain points, and uncover opportunities where AI can add significant value.
This involves collaborating with organizational stakeholders to gather insights and define clear objectives for AI projects.
Designing AI Models and Algorithms Tailored to Specific Business Problems
Once the opportunities are identified, AI consultants design custom AI models and algorithms to address specific business problems.
They leverage their expertise in machine learning, deep learning, and data analytics to develop solutions that are effective, scalable, and adaptable to the client’s unique requirements.
Implementing AI Solutions and Integrating Them into Existing Systems
AI consultants oversee the implementation of AI solutions, ensuring they are seamlessly integrated into the client’s existing systems and processes.
This includes setting up the necessary infrastructure, configuring software, and deploying AI models. They work closely with IT teams to ensure smooth integration and minimal disruption to business operations.
Evaluating the Performance of AI Systems and Making Necessary Adjustments
After implementation, AI consultants continuously evaluate the performance of AI systems to ensure they meet the desired outcomes.
They use various metrics and analytics tools to monitor performance, identify issues, and make necessary adjustments. This iterative process helps fine-tune AI models and improve their accuracy and effectiveness over time.
Providing Ongoing Support and Maintenance
AI consultants provide ongoing support and maintenance to ensure the long-term success of AI initiatives. This includes regular updates to AI models, addressing technical issues, and providing continuous training and support to users.
By offering sustained support, AI consultants help businesses maximize the value of their AI investments and stay ahead in a rapidly evolving technological landscape. Can harness the power of AI to solve complex challenges, innovate, and thrive in the digital age.
Skills and Qualifications
Technical Skills Required
AI consultants must possess robust technical skills to develop, implement, and optimize AI solutions effectively.
Key technical skills include:
- Machine Learning: Understanding various machine learning algorithms and their applications, including supervised and unsupervised learning, reinforcement learning, and deep learning.
- Data Analysis: Proficiency in data analysis techniques, including statistical analysis, data mining, and data visualization, to interpret and derive insights from large datasets.
- Programming Languages: Expertise in programming languages commonly used in AI, such as Python, R, Java, and C++. Familiarity with AI frameworks and libraries like TensorFlow, PyTorch, and scikit-learn is also essential.
- Big Data Technologies: Knowledge of big data platforms and tools, such as Hadoop, Spark, and NoSQL databases, to handle and process vast amounts of data efficiently.
- AI and ML Tools: Experience with AI and machine learning tools and platforms, such as AWS SageMaker, Google AI Platform, and Microsoft Azure AI, to develop and deploy AI models.
Soft Skills
In addition to technical expertise, AI consultants need a range of soft skills to manage projects, communicate effectively, and solve problems:
- Communication: Explain complex AI concepts to non-technical stakeholders and collaborate effectively with cross-functional teams.
- Problem-Solving: Strong analytical and critical thinking skills to identify issues, develop innovative solutions, and troubleshoot problems as they arise.
- Project Management: Proficiency in project management techniques to plan, execute, and monitor AI projects, ensuring they are completed on time and within budget.
- Adaptability: The ability to stay current with the latest AI technologies and methodologies and adapt to the ever-evolving landscape of artificial intelligence.
Educational Background and Certifications
AI consultants typically have a strong educational background in fields related to computer science, data science, or engineering. Relevant degrees and certifications include:
- Bachelor’s or Master’s Degree: Computer science, data science, engineering, mathematics, or related fields provide a solid foundation in AI principles and practices.
- PhD: A PhD in AI, machine learning, or a related field can be highly beneficial for more advanced roles.
- Certifications: Certifications from recognized institutions, such as the Certified AI Professional (CAIP), Google Cloud Professional Data Engineer, or Microsoft Certified: Azure AI Engineer Associate, can enhance credibility and demonstrate expertise.
Experience and Industry Knowledge
Practical experience and industry knowledge are crucial for AI consultants to understand the unique challenges and opportunities within different sectors:
Project Experience: Hands-on experience with AI projects, from initial concept to full-scale deployment, helps consultants understand the practical aspects of implementing AI solutions and managing real-world challenges. Technologies are fully understood across the organization.
Industry Experience: Experience working in specific industries, such as finance, healthcare, retail, or manufacturing, allows AI consultants to tailor solutions to the unique needs and requirements of those sectors.
Types of AI Consulting Services
Strategic AI Consulting
Strategic AI consulting focuses on helping businesses develop comprehensive strategies for AI adoption and integration. Key services include:
- Business Case Development: AI consultants work with clients to develop compelling business cases for AI initiatives, highlighting potential benefits, ROI, and strategic value.
- AI Readiness Assessment: Evaluating the organization’s current capabilities, infrastructure, and readiness for AI adoption to identify gaps and areas for improvement.
- Roadmap Creation: Creating detailed roadmaps for AI implementation, outlining the steps, timelines, and resources required to achieve the desired outcomes.
Technical AI Consulting
Technical AI consulting involves the development and deployment of AI models and solutions. Key services include:
- Model Development: Designing and developing custom AI models and algorithms to address specific business problems and optimize operations.
- Data Engineering: Building and maintaining data pipelines, ensuring the availability, quality, and integrity of data used for AI applications.
- System Integration: Integrating AI solutions with existing systems and infrastructure, ensuring seamless operation and minimal disruption to business processes.
Operational AI Consulting
Operational AI consulting focuses on the ongoing management and optimization of AI systems to ensure they deliver continuous value. Key services include:
- Process Automation: Implementing AI-driven automation solutions to streamline workflows, reduce manual effort, and increase efficiency.
- Performance Monitoring: Continuously monitoring the performance of AI systems, identifying issues, and making necessary adjustments to maintain optimal functionality.
- Continuous Improvement: Providing ongoing support and updates to AI models and systems, incorporating new data and insights to improve accuracy and effectiveness over time.
The Path to Becoming an AI Consultant
Becoming an AI consultant requires a unique blend of skills, encompassing both deep technical knowledge of artificial intelligence and a strong understanding of business processes and strategies.
This dual expertise enables AI consultants to bridge the gap between AI technology’s potential and practical business applications.
Steps to pursue a career in AI consultancy:
- Acquire a strong foundation in AI and machine learning: This typically involves obtaining a degree in computer science, data science, or a related field, supplemented by specialized courses in AI and ML technologies.
- Gain practical experience: Hands-on experience with AI projects, either through internships, employment, or personal projects, is crucial. This helps in understanding the real-world application of AI technologies.
- Develop business insight: Understanding business operations, strategy, and management is key. This can be achieved through formal education, such as an MBA or practical business experience.
- Build a portfolio: Demonstrating your ability to apply AI solutions to solve business problems is essential. A portfolio of projects showcasing your skills can be a significant asset.
- Stay updated: AI is a rapidly evolving field. Continuous learning through courses, workshops, and industry conferences is vital to keeping up with the latest technologies and methodologies.
By following these steps, aspiring AI consultants can develop the necessary expertise to advise businesses on navigating the complex landscape of artificial intelligence, ensuring that AI investments are aligned with strategic goals and deliver tangible benefits.
FAQs in AI Consultancy
What is the primary role of an AI consultant? An AI consultant helps businesses integrate artificial intelligence technologies to solve specific problems, improve decision-making, and innovate. They provide strategic guidance, technical expertise, and support throughout the implementation process.
What types of industries can benefit from AI consulting? AI consulting benefits various industries, including finance, healthcare, retail, manufacturing, and logistics. Each sector can leverage AI to address unique challenges and drive growth.
What technical skills should an AI consultant possess? AI consultants need skills in machine learning, data analysis, programming (Python, R, Java), big data technologies, and familiarity with AI frameworks and tools like TensorFlow and PyTorch.
Why is industry knowledge important for an AI consultant? Industry knowledge allows AI consultants to tailor their solutions to the specific needs and challenges of the sector they are working in, ensuring more relevant and effective AI applications.
How does an AI consultant assess a company’s readiness for AI? An AI consultant evaluates the company’s current infrastructure, data quality, technological capabilities, and overall organizational readiness to adopt and support AI initiatives.
What is involved in developing an AI strategy? Developing an AI strategy includes setting clear goals, identifying key performance indicators, creating a roadmap for implementation, and ensuring alignment with the company’s objectives.
How do AI consultants design custom AI models? They understand the specific business problems, select appropriate algorithms, train the models with relevant data, and validate their performance to ensure they meet the desired outcomes.
What is the process of integrating AI solutions into existing systems? Integrating AI solutions involves configuring the AI models to work with the current IT infrastructure, ensuring compatibility, minimizing disruptions, and testing to confirm seamless operation.
How do AI consultants monitor the performance of AI systems? They use various metrics and analytics tools to track the AI system’s performance, identify issues, and make necessary adjustments to maintain optimal functionality.
What kind of ongoing support do AI consultants provide? Ongoing support includes troubleshooting technical problems, updating AI models, providing user training, and offering guidance on best practices for managing and maintaining AI systems.
Why is problem-solving an important skill for AI consultants? Problem-solving skills are crucial because AI consultants must identify business challenges, develop innovative solutions, and address issues arising during and after implementation.
What educational background is typical for an AI consultant? AI consultants often have degrees in computer science, data science, engineering, mathematics, or related fields. Advanced degrees or specialized certifications can further demonstrate expertise.
How do AI consultants help with process automation? They identify repetitive and manual tasks that can be automated using AI, design and implement automation solutions, and ensure these solutions integrate smoothly with existing workflows.
What are the benefits of AI readiness assessments? AI readiness assessments help organizations understand their current capabilities, identify gaps, and create a structured plan to prepare for AI adoption, ensuring a smoother and more effective implementation process.
How do AI consultants ensure the ethical use of AI? AI consultants advocate for responsible AI practices by developing transparent models, ensuring data privacy, avoiding biases, and adhering to ethical guidelines and regulations in AI applications.
What does an AI consultant do? An AI consultant helps businesses integrate and leverage AI technologies to solve problems, improve decision-making, and drive innovation. They provide strategic advice, develop AI models, implement solutions, and offer ongoing support.
How much does an AI consultant cost? The cost varies widely based on the consultant’s experience, the complexity of the project, and the industry. Rates can range from $100 to $500 per hour or more for highly specialized expertise.
How much do AI consultants make? Depending on their experience, location, and the demand for their skills, AI consultants can make between $80,000 and $200,000 annually.
How do you become an AI consultant? To become an AI consultant, you typically need a strong educational background in computer science or a related field, hands-on experience with AI projects, and skills in machine learning, data analysis, and programming.
What is the salary of an AI consultant at Google? The salary of an AI consultant at Google can range from $150,000 to $200,000 per year, depending on experience and specific roles within the company.
What is the salary of an AI consultant at Deloitte? AI consultants at Deloitte typically earn between $100,000 and $150,000 annually, based on their experience and position within the firm.
How to become an AI consultant with no experience? To become an AI consultant with no experience, start by gaining foundational knowledge in AI and machine learning through online courses, build a portfolio of AI projects, seek internships, and network with professionals in the field.
How much does 1 AI cost? The cost of developing and implementing an AI solution can vary greatly, from a few thousand dollars for simple applications to millions for complex, enterprise-level systems.
How to start an AI consulting business? To start an AI consulting business, you need expertise in AI, a clear business plan, a network of potential clients, and initial capital. Offering specialized services and building a strong portfolio will help attract clients.
Can I make money with AI? Yes, you can make money with AI by developing and selling AI-based products, offering consulting services, or working for AI technology companies.
Is AI a high-paying job? AI is generally considered a high-paying field, with salaries often exceeding those in other tech-related roles due to the specialized skills and high demand.
How to become a freelance AI consultant? To become a freelance AI consultant, build a strong portfolio, establish an online presence, network with potential clients, and offer competitive rates to attract initial business.
Where can I learn AI for free? You can learn AI for free through online platforms such as Coursera, edX, and Udacity, which offer courses from universities and organizations like Stanford and Google.
What is the role of an AI consultant? The role of an AI consultant includes assessing business needs, designing AI models, implementing AI solutions, integrating them into existing systems, and providing ongoing support and optimization.
How to become a high-paid AI consultant? To become a high-paid AI consultant, focus on gaining advanced skills, specializing in high-demand areas, building a strong portfolio, and continuously updating your knowledge to stay in the field.
What is the hourly rate for an AI consultant? The rate typically ranges from $100 to $500, depending on the expertise and complexity of the project.
How long does it take to become an AI expert? Becoming an AI expert can take several years, including obtaining a relevant degree, gaining practical experience, and continuously learning through advanced courses and hands-on projects.
How do I start a small AI business? To start a small AI business, identify a niche market, develop a strong business plan, secure initial funding, build a team with AI expertise, and offer specialized AI services or products.
How do I start my AI career? To start an AI career, pursue a degree in computer science or a related field, gain experience through internships or projects, and continuously build your AI and machine learning skills.
How do I get my first AI job? To get your first AI job, create a strong resume highlighting relevant skills and projects, apply for entry-level positions or internships, and network with professionals in the AI industry.
Does AI pay well? Yes, AI careers are generally well-paying, often offering salaries higher than many other tech roles due to the specialized skills and high demand for AI professionals.